This batch is reserved for pin 0
Description
Message prompted: ”This batch is reserved for pin 0”, when user login as Pin_4 and add transaction into the batch. The solution below is is explaining the fact of this issue and will show the steps to overcome it.
Solution
That was because Batch 2 was created and reserved for Pin_0. To allow Pin_4 access to Batch 2, the steps are:
1. Logout and login again using Pin_0;
2. Go to Boss menu, click on “Change Batch Lock Status & Pin No.“, in Pin column against Batch 2,
change the pin from 0 to 04; Exit.
3. Logout and login again as Pin_4, now you should be able to access to Batch 2.
